I assume the brake is off when you have the turntable on?
First thing to do is to disassemble the motor (WARNING: MAKE SURE THE SPRING IS COMPLETELY RUN DOWN FIRST!) and thoroughly clean it; when you've got it back together, oil all the bearings and the governor with sewing machine oil. See how it performs then.
If it still doesn't spin with the turntable on, chances are that the mainspring is weak, and needs to be replaced. Check the Links section of the Forum for repairers: there are some good sources for new mainsprings.
Once you've got the motor running properly, you can go on to rebuilding the reproducer.
